  • what: This study shows that microsporidians in are abundant and diverse but do not show obvious patterns related to host genetic lineages or geography. The aim of this study was to obtain a first overview of the presence and diversity of microsporidian parasites in the genetically heterogenous aquatic isopod A. aquaticus from a wide geographical range, which also allowed the . . .
